Exploring the Beauty and Durability of Cast Iron Ornamental Designs in Home Decor



The Timeless Beauty of Cast Iron Ornamental Design


Cast iron has long been revered as one of the most enduring materials in architectural history, particularly appreciated for its beauty, durability, and versatility. Among its many applications, ornamental cast iron has captured the imaginations of designers, architects, and artisans, transforming mundane spaces into stunning exhibitions of artistry. The unique qualities of cast iron not only enhance the aesthetic of environments but also underscore the craftsmanship involved in its creation.


The History of Cast Iron Ornamental Design


The use of cast iron dates back to ancient China, but it gained widespread popularity during the Industrial Revolution in the 18th and 19th centuries. With advancements in metallurgy and production techniques, cast iron became an accessible material for decorative purposes. Ornamental cast iron was used extensively in public buildings, bridges, railings, balconies, and fences, offering an affordable yet artistic solution for architects and builders. Victorian-era designs, in particular, showcased elaborate patterns, intricate detailing, and a variety of motifs that reflected the ornamental style of the time.


Characteristics of Cast Iron


Cast iron is renowned for its remarkable durability. Unlike many other materials, it can withstand the test of time, faithfully preserving the craftsmanship over decades and even centuries. This resilience makes it ideal for outdoor applications, where it is exposed to the elements. Moreover, cast iron exhibits excellent tensile strength, allowing it to support complex designs without compromising structural integrity.


Another distinctive feature of cast iron ornamental designs is the potential for intricate detailing. The manufacturing process allows artists to create delicate patterns, scrolls, and filigree that would be challenging to achieve using other construction materials. This capability has led to an artistic renaissance in public spaces, parks, gardens, and historical buildings, where beautifully crafted elements captivate visitors.

The Restoration and Repurposing of Cast Iron


As urban environments evolve, many cities are recognizing the historical and cultural significance of their cast iron features. Restoration projects aimed at preserving these ornamental elements have become increasingly common, ensuring that future generations can appreciate their beauty. Moreover, the trend of repurposing cast iron elements has gained popularity. Old railings can be transformed into stylish interior decor, while discarded benches can be restored and integrated into modern outdoor spaces.


DIY enthusiasts and artists have also embraced cast iron to create unique art pieces and functional items. From sculptures to kitchenware, the versatility of cast iron allows for innovative applications that honor traditional craftsmanship while adding contemporary flair.
